Bourque: The beginning of the end of too big to fail?

Michèle Bourque, President and CEO of the Canada Deposit Insurance Corporation, discusses the progress being made in Canada in response to recent calls from the Financial Stability Board to implement regulations that will put an end to bailouts and “too big to fail.” Bourque explains the steps the CDIC takes when a financial institution fails, and the role of the CDIC in providing security for the financial industry and Canadian consumers. Bourque spoke to Paula Virany, multimedia editor and video producer with Investment Executive at the TMX Broadcast Centre in Toronto.
